YouTube Tightens Measures Against Ad Blocking

YouTube has recently tightened measures against ad blocking, closing loopholes that ad blockers used to bypass ad displays. Some users now cannot watch videos unless they add YouTube to the allowed list in their ad blocker or completely disable ad blocking. These changes have caused user dissatisfaction, but not all users are affected as the measures are not yet implemented in all regions.
